页面属性配置节点,用于指定页面的一些属性、监听页面事件。可部分替代pages.json的功能。 从微信基础库2.9.0开始,新增了page-meta组件,它是一个特殊的标签,有点类似html里的header标签。页面的背景色、原生导航栏的参数,都可以写在page-meta里。HBuilderX 2.6.3+ 支持了这个组件,并且全平台都实现了。 从某种意义...
小程序中的 page-meta 和 HTML 中的header设置meta比较类似,可以对页面的一些属性进行配置。 令人困惑的是,page-meta 的功能和 page.json 的功能及相关api的功能是重复的,提供page-meta这种方式,貌似只是一种语法糖,提供了另外一种风格。而且,page-meta 的执行效率还不如 page.json。 page-meta、page.json 及 ...
小程序中的 page-meta 和 HTML 中的header设置meta比较类似,可以对页面的一些属性进行配置。 令人困惑的是,page-meta 的功能和 page.json 的功能及相关api的功能是重复的,提供page-meta这种方式,貌似只是一种语法糖,提供了另外一种风格。而且,page-meta 的执行效率还不如 page.json。 page-meta、page.json 及 ...
在HTML中,我们通常使用以下meta标签来禁止用户缩放: AI检测代码解析 <metaname="viewport"content="width=device-width, initial-scale=1.0, maximum-scale=1.0, user-scalable=no"> 1. 然而,在iOS设备上,即使设置了user-scalable=no,用户仍然可以对页面进行缩放。这是因为iOS系统对viewport的默认行为是允许用户缩放...
vite-uni-pagemeta 📖 简介 此插件能够解决 uniapp 打包后,在指定文件夹所有页面中加上 page-meta 标签,而不需要每个页面手动去加。 微信提示:页面属性配置节点,用于指定页面的一些属性、监听页面事件。只能是页面内的第一个节点。 <page-meta root-font-size="fontSize" data-theme="dataTheme" data-layo...
uniapp 命令 manifest uni-app老年模式字体设置一、实现原理 借助插件,将项目中的字体单位rpx换成rem,结合官网提供的page-meta属性,通过控制根字体大小,达到调节字体大小的要求。 em:font size of the element,是相对于父元素的字体大小单位; rem:font size of the root element,是指相对于根元素的字体大小单位;...
新功能描述 支持 page-meta 编写为独立组件而非必须在每个页面都写一遍 现状及问题 当应用涉及到皮肤、主题等色彩配置时,需凭借 page-meta 组件的能力来控制页面 backgroundColor、backgroundColorTop、backgroundColorBottom 等属性。一般来说开发者会使用 vuex / pinia
在上述代码中,我们使用了 page-meta 组件来动态修改页面的 overflow 属性,通过绑定 show10 变量的值来控制页面的滚动。当 show10 为true 时,底层页面的滚动被禁止,从而解决了滚动穿透问题。 2. 禁止Popup内容区域的滚动穿透 注意:在h5平台可以通过动态修改body标签的样式,设置 overflow:hidden 即可解决滚动穿透,无循...
使用page-meta页面属性配置节点,用于指定页面的一些属性、监听页面事件。可部分替代pages.json的功能。 具体用法:https://uniapp.dcloud.io/component/page-meta <template> <page-meta> <navigation-bar :background-color="theme":title="nbTitle"/>
<template> <page-meta v-bind="pageMetaBindValue"> <navigation-bar v-bind="navigationBarBindValue" /> </page-meta> <view class="content"> <slot /> </view> </template> <script setup lang="ts"> import type { WrapperPropsType } from './wrapper' import { omit } from 'lodash-es' im...